Output 5ba95042e1ed5bbbb013d76d8c8467382d90d5856d0dc80d85f895a8a087c8e2:29

value
516406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a91c809574a3d35e7ca7e2b2a2e248a119e2cf9 OP_EQUAL
address
3Cs711sNzLXTYaVmwBryZSS7KbE62B4xfZ
transaction
5ba95042e1ed5bbbb013d76d8c8467382d90d5856d0dc80d85f895a8a087c8e2
spent
true